How does Walshville, IL compare to Berlin, IL? Walshville has a population of 96 with a median household income of $92,083, while Berlin has 97 residents and a median income of $68,250.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Walshville, IL | Berlin, IL |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 96 | 97 | -1.0% |
| Median Age | 36.9 | 57.3 | -35.6% |
| Foreign Born % | 0% | 0% | — |
| Metric | Walshville | Berlin |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$92,083 | $68,250 | +34.9% |
| Unemployment | 24.1% | 0% | +2410.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 5.2% | 10.3% | -49.5% |
| Bachelor's+ | 4.3% | 5.3% | -18.9% |
